Wheelbase: 102" Track: 57" Front / 58.8" Rear Height: 51.5" Over Windshield
Length: 167.3" Width: 69.8" Curb Weight: 2,886 lbs.
Tire Size: 6.70x15" Plant: St. Louis

For 1954, Corvette production moved to a newly renovated facility in St. Louis Missouri where 10,000 Corvettes were expected to be built every year. Actual production began in December of 1953. Production for 1954 was 3,640 units. Nearly one third remained unsold in December of 1954. Mid year production saw a camshaft change that increased horsepower to 155 in the 235ci six cylinder engine, all Corvettes produced retained the Powerglide automatic transmission. Three new colors, Pennant Blue, Sportsman Red, and Black were added along with the standard Polo White. A beige interior was also offered.

Serial Numbers: E54S001001 through E54S004640

Base Engine: 235ci "Blueflame" 150hp (155hp after mid-year cam change)
